Episode Synopsis "#8 Turns Out My Autistic Sister Is A Conceptual Artist"
Understanding Autism through making art, my sister's innate sense of lines and curves which are the intrinsic language of the universe, the pleasurable sensation of movement, filling space and emptying it, my Synaesthesia. Words are pictures and we are all living, breathing, moving paintings and drawings. Image: Drawing by Verity Hemken
